Stock flowers offer a wonderfully spicy, distinctive scent reminiscent of cloves. Stock flower (matthiola incana), also known as gillyflower or hoary stock, is a hardy plant which brings splashes of colour and a sweet and spicy fragrance to a garden. These annual flowers come in a range of colors and are usually grown from seed. Matthiola incana is a species of flowering plant in the cabbage family brassicaceae. Stock, matthiola incana, is a member of the brassicaceae family of plants that includes cabbages. Stock is native to the mediterranean and spread to japan in the 17th century.
